SpaceX successfully launched the historic Fram-2 mission, which marked the first time humans traveled over Earth's poles in a commercial spacecraft. Named after the Norwegian 'Fram' ship that explored both poles in the early 20th century, the mission launched aboard a Falcon 9 rocket and Crew Dragon capsule 'Resilience' from Launch Complex-39A at NASA's Kennedy Space Center in Florida. Conducted in partnership with NASA and private space tourists, the mission demonstrated SpaceX's advanced navigation and safety systems while the crew performed scientific experiments orbiting over the Arctic and Antarctic regions. This milestone opens possibilities for future polar space tourism and more efficient satellite deployments. The privately funded mission carried four astronauts on a 3-5 day orbital journey and tested new radiation shielding for future deep-space travel.
